Ford Testing Intelligent System for Plug-in Vehicle to Grid Communication to Manage Charging

Green Car Congress

Ford Motor Company has developed an intelligent vehicle-to-grid communications and control system for its plug-in hybrid electric vehicles that communicates directly with the electric grid. All 21 of Ford’s fleet of plug-in hybrid Escapes eventually will be equipped with the vehicle-to-grid communications technology.

Magnetic-Confinement Fusion Without the Magnets

Cars That Think

This Z-pinch approach—so named because the current pinches the plasma along the third, or Z , axis of a three-dimensional grid—could potentially produce energy in a device that’s simpler, smaller, and cheaper than the massive tokamaks or laser-fusion machines under development today.
